Ground broken for condos at former Parisi’s Site

Pixabay.com
Construction is getting underway on a new condominium development near the Notre Dame campus.
The former Parisi’s Ristorante property will become the Parisi Condos, featuring 38 two-bedroom units. Developers say 14 units have already been spoken for.
The remaining condos are priced from roughly 711-thousand to 965-thousand dollars. Plans include a rooftop deck, fitness center and putting green.
Developer Steve Smith says demand remains strong from both local residents and people looking for a second home near Notre Dame. The project is expected to be finished in August of 2027, with move-ins planned that fall.
